Key ceremony checklist, item 7 (Quillbase KV store): Verify the Bloom filter shard in front of the Quillbase cluster has been rebuilt against the post-rotation keyspace. False-negative rate must read below 0.1% on the ceremony dashboard before signing off. If the filter admin partition is still sealed from the previous rotation, unseal it with the recovery passphrase recorded for this ceremony, appended directly beneath this item for the release manager's use.

strongbox words: istwyn-normir-silwyn-ulaius-istwyn

Hey — quick handover on the Tallowgrove payroll export. Finance switched from fixed-width to delimited files last sprint, so the old parser alerts are noise now; ack and close those. The new exporter runs at 05:30 and retries twice. If it fails a third time, page me. Current exporter configuration is below.

deployment values, bahof-badug:
[rusix]
team = zorok
access_code = ac_641cbe
owner = ulair.tamius
host = rusix.torvasoft.local
port = 5672
peer = ulaix.sivrelworks.internal
salt = 1df570ed
pin = 6327

14:32 — Load test against the Karrowpay checkout flow began at 400 virtual users, ramping to 1,200 over ten minutes. At 14:41 the payment-intent service saturated its connection pool and p99 latency rose to 6.4s. Dana from the Fennwick platform team throttled the ramp at 14:44, and latencies recovered within two minutes. No customer-facing traffic was affected since the test ran in the Brightmoor staging cluster. The exact build under test is recorded below for the release manager's records.

pipeline stamp: htk3_cc5